About Queens

Queens is the largest of the five boroughs that make up New York City. It has a population of just over two million, and it is the most ethnically diverse urban area. It also has the second-largest economy of all five boroughs, with a range of jobs in various industries.

Queens holds sectors for film and tv production, health care, transportation, construction, and retail. The borough is also full of small businesses, with two-thirds of them only employing between one and four people. Two out of three of NYC’s major airports are located in Queens; LaGuardia and JFK International. Queens sits adjacent to Brooklyn, located in the western end of Long Island.

There are dozens of unique neighborhoods that make up Queens, and each one has its own culture and atmosphere. Many of New York’s most famous attractions are located in this borough, including Silvercup Studios, Aqueduct Racetrack, and Flushing Meadows Park.

Pros and Cons of Production Spaces in Queens

There are pros and cons to NYC, but Queens has its own good and bad sides to consider. Make sure you know what you are getting into before committing to a production space in Queens.

Advantages

  • Diversity
    The entirety of New York City is known for diversity, but Queens is the most ethnically diverse of its five boroughs. This is reflected in the restaurants found in every neighborhood, with many of them offering a range of ethnic cuisines.

  • Affordability
    New York is known for being expensive, but not every borough is the same. Queens is notorious for being the cheapest borough in the Big Apple, whether you’re looking to eat out, book a hotel room, or rent an apartment.

  • Easy to get around
    When it comes to getting around, New York is one of the easiest cities to explore. You can take the public transportation network nearly anywhere in Queens, or other places in the city. New York is also walk-friendly, and many locals don’t even own a car.

Disadvantages

  • Commute times
    It might be fairly easy to get around Queens, but it is known to have longer commute times than New York’s other boroughs. This is mainly due to the size of it, and it’s important to plan on spending extra time in traffic.

  • Brutal winters
    The winter season in Queens can be brutal. Snowstorms are common, and the wind is bitterly cold. This can be especially difficult in a city where many people choose to get around on foot. If you’ll be in Queens during winter, it’s best to plan ahead for the cold weather.

  • Fast pace
    New York is known for being busy, and this is especially true in a large place like Queens. NYC has been deemed the city that never sleeps for a reason, and that will become apparent to anyone visiting.

Famous Locations in Queens

  • Flushing Meadows Corona Park
    The biggest park in Queens, New York is Flushing Meadows, Corona Park. There are other major attractions inside the park, including the Botanical Garden and Citi Field. The Unisphere, a giant representation of Earth, is one of the most iconic attractions in Flushing Meadows.

  • Queens Museum
    Queens Museum, located inside Flushing Meadows Corona Park, is another famous attraction in the borough. It was constructed for the 1964 New York World’s Fair and has been updated over the years. There is a permanent collection in the museum that has more than 10,000 works of art.

  • Alley Pond Park
    Alley Pond Park is the second-largest park in Queens, New York with over 655 acres. It is home to the Queens Giant, the tallest and oldest tree in the city. The tree is estimated to be around 300 or 400 years old. Visitors can see the entire park on an Urban Park Ranger Tour. But make sure you visit the environmental center where they have animal exhibits, a museum, and a library.
